Name origin and meaning

Balva originates primarily from Latvian linguistic roots and holds a symbolic meaning related to distinction and recognition. The word itself translates directly to 'prize,' 'award,' or 'trophy' in the Latvian language. This powerful connotation suggests that the name was historically chosen to bestow a sense of value and importance upon the bearer. It is deeply embedded in the cultural lexicon of the Baltic states, functioning as a direct substantive noun adapted for personal nomenclature.

Name days: Name Balva

This list shows name days in different countries where the name is written in the same form. The dates are based on traditional calendars and cultural name celebrations. If your name matches exactly, you can see when it is honored in various parts of the world.

Country Month Day Name days 
Latvia Latvia September 6 Balva, Magnuss, Maigonis 
Latvia Latvia December 23 Balva, Viktorija
